If your security cameras are located in the wrong areas of your home, you may not be as protected as you think. Here are a few tips for from Rotorua’s leading security surveillance provider Renlick for putting your security cameras where they work best in keeping your home safe.

In a recent study an estimated 34% of all burglars enter your home through the front door, so you’ll definitely need a security camera watching that area. “Place the camera above the door or window frame, facing downward so that it covers the area a few feet in front of the opening,” says Melody Cheng from Renlick.

Having a security camera on the front door is also great because you can use it to see who's at the door before answering.

It is also a good idea to place a security camera near off-street windows as a lot of home intruders think that they can reduce their chances of getting caught by home by entering through a rear window, away from the view of the street and from any cars passing by. “Place a camera at any off-street windows to keep your home from thieves and vandals,” adds Melody

Don’t forget about security for your backyard. Things like expensive garden machinery and recreational equipment left out can attract intruders to your yard. Try setting up wide-angle security camera to cover the main area of your backyard as well as entry points, this could be areas like fence gates or places where intruders can scale the fence.

Put your cameras where burglars are most likely to enter is good rule to follow. It’s also a good idea to keep cameras out of reach. Easily accessible cameras can be torn down or destroyed by potential intruders. “Make sure the cameras are visible though, as often the site of a camera can scare off potential intruders,” advises Melody.
